Output bf14ec1b774af30bd23dd5e36a5e74e091d7d4abcbc8acabcf13b4131957ef21:1

value
16813072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6c8853fbb813bc0fea9473fc525b61521d03c0 OP_EQUAL
address
3QcRYfZbZb7CkUtkfLb8vsAwwqXAMQPoHG
transaction
bf14ec1b774af30bd23dd5e36a5e74e091d7d4abcbc8acabcf13b4131957ef21
confirmations
381453
spent
true